Take Scrolling Screenshot On Samsung Galaxy Z Fold 6

Open the Desired Page: Start by opening the page where you want to capture a scrolling screenshot.

    Take Scrolling Screenshot On Samsung Galaxy Z Fold 6

    Capture a Screenshot: Press the side key and volume down button simultaneously, or swipe down for quick settings and tap “Take screenshot.”

    Take Scrolling Screenshot On Samsung Galaxy Z Fold 6

    Access the Toolbar: After capturing your screenshot, a toolbar will appear at the bottom of the screen.

    Take Scrolling Screenshot On Samsung Galaxy Z Fold 6

    Initiate Scrolling Screenshot: Tap the icon on the toolbar that appears after taking a screenshot.

      Take Scrolling Screenshot On Samsung Galaxy Z Fold 6

      Extend the Screenshot: Each time you tap the icon, the screenshot will extend, capturing more of the page.

      Capture the Entire Page: Continue tapping the icon until you have captured the full page.

      View the Screenshot: Tap on the thumbnail of the scrolling screenshot that appears.

      Take Scrolling Screenshot On Samsung Galaxy Z Fold 6

      Edit or Share: From here, you can choose to view, edit, share, or delete the scrolling screenshot. You can also use Google Lens for additional functionality.

        Take Scrolling Screenshot On Samsung Galaxy Z Fold 6

        Finish: Once you’re done, your scrolling screenshot will be saved and ready for use.
